Our Nurses work in collaborative environments with strong interdisciplinary teams, focused on a patient centered care model in a richly diverse work space. Under the direction and general supervision of the Nurse Manager, the registered nurse utilizes evidence based practices in accordance with the State Nurse Practice Act, policies and procedures of the hospital and as directed by the medical staff. The registered nurse who through knowledge and ability uses the nursing process to develop a plan of care which includes standards of practice to meet the physical, emotional spiritual, cultural and educational needs of the patient and family.

Requirements

  • Current Connecticut RN License
  • Graduate of an accredited nursing school
  • ASN Required (Must obtain a BSN within 6 years of starting in the RN role)
  • BSN preferred
  • BLS certification by the American Heart Association required prior to date of hire
